Habibganj in Madhya Pradesh and Gandhi Nagar in Gujarat will be India’s first railway stations to be operationalised under the public-private partnership (PPP) scheme as the Indian Railways sets in motion its station redevelopment plan.

The Indian Railway Stations Development Corporation (IRSDC) stated that both the stations will offer space for retail, office spaces, food and beverage set-ups.

In Habibganj, the developer will monetise 1,70,000 sq ft land while in Gandhi Nagar, a five-star hotel has been built on the railway tracks, which will also be inaugurated shortly. These stations will become a model for future development as it plans to redevelop more stations under the PPP mode.

Of the 123 stations currently available for redevelopment, the Railways aims to issue tenders for 50 by March 2021. The government plans to open up about 20 million sq ft real estate, attracting investment of Rs 50,000 crore.

Some of the major stations, work for which has been awarded this financial year include Delhi, Mumbai, Nagpur, Amritsar, Dehradun, Nellore, Tirupati and Puducherry.

Habibganj railway station was redeveloped as a brownfield project under a PPP agreement signed in March 2017. The developer has 45 years lease rights for 17,245 sq mtr of railway land. The responsibility of the station’s operation, maintenance and revenue collection is also with the developer for eight years.

IRSDC will get a fixed percentage of station revenue as its management fee, without any expenditure for operations and management.

The redevelopment of Gandhinagar Capital Railway Station project, with a 300-room five-star hotel, has been completed by special purpose vehicle (SPV), the Gandhinagar Railway & Urban Development Corporation.

The SPV was formed with equity contribution of the government of Gujarat and IRSDC in the ratio of 74:26 respectively.

Habibganj brownfield PPP project will pave the way for other interested private developers to invest in similar upcoming projects. IRSDC is also executing redevelopment of Mumbai’s CSMT station.
